原文:hive实践之map类型插入单条数据

hive原本不是用来做简单的crud的,但有时候我们就是有可能这么干,怎么办呢 hive 还是提供了相应的功能的,查询是最必须的,就无须多说了。 插入数据一般来说都是大批量的插入,一般用于从源数据中导入数据到hive中,然后经过hive加工后,写入到一张新的结果表。而这个表的数据一般也会很大,具体看业务复杂性。 更新数据一般是不会被支持的,尤其是想更新某一条数据,但我们可以通过重新刷入数据的方式 ...

2021-01-07 09:05 0 1613 推荐指数:

查看详情

hive-map类型字段的定义与插入

map类型定义了一种kv结构,在hive中经常使用。如何定义map类型呢? 其中fields是字段分隔符,collection是每个kv对的分隔符,map keys是k与v的分隔符 导入数据时,只需要按对应分隔符处理好数据即可 ...

Wed Apr 17 01:53:00 CST 2019 0 823
Hive:建表、插入数据插入复合类型

新建hive表: 查看建好的表的结构: 插入数据hive 不支持直接用insert插入复合类型(如test表中struct类型列),可以用以下方式间接插入 补充: Hive数据文件如果是parquet类型,struct复合类型里的类型为timestamp的列 ...

Fri Jan 04 00:12:00 CST 2019 0 823
hive笔记:复杂数据类型-map结构

map 结构 1. 语法:map(k1,v1,k2,v2,…) 操作类型mapmap类型数据可以通过'列名['key']的方式访问 案例: select deductions['Federal Taxes'],deductions['State Taxes ...

Fri Nov 02 02:08:00 CST 2018 0 18033
MongoDB插入条数据

刚开始学mongodb,只知道几个命令,insert插入也只能一条一条插入,而在实际情况下数据一般都非常多,刚开始想直接上传json文件,网上搜了n多方法发现这种方法不好弄,然后就想着要么一下子把多条数据插进去不就好了。 insertMany方法可以插入条数据,但写法也是有要求的,在shell ...

Sat Mar 31 01:39:00 CST 2018 0 5373
Mybatis同时插入条数据

Mybatis插入条数据,使用标签<foreach> 解释: collection:传入的参数,可以在dao层方法里定义@Param别名 index:循环的下标 separator:每个对象的分隔符(也是进行下一次循环的标识符) item:集合中元 ...

Sat Oct 19 23:17:00 CST 2019 0 749
Oracle 怎么同时插入条数据

SQL语句向表中插入多个值的话,如果如下语句 INSERT INTO 某表 VALUES(各个值),VALUES(各个值),.....; 这样会报错的,因为oracle是不支持这种写法的,如果多个INSERT INTO VALUEES(各个值);这样以“;”隔开一同执行也是不行的,oracle ...

Fri Nov 20 01:35:00 CST 2020 0 824
 
粤ICP备18138465号  © 2018-2025 CODEPRJ.COM